1. Trang chủ
  2. » Giáo án - Bài giảng

bai tap trac nghiem Tin 11 mang xau(hay)

2 537 3

Đang tải... (xem toàn văn)

THÔNG TIN TÀI LIỆU

Thông tin cơ bản

Định dạng
Số trang 2
Dung lượng 44,5 KB
File đính kèm THUC HANH111_1_061.rar (7 KB)

Nội dung

Họ tên: Lớp: Câu 1: Trong ngôn ngữ lập trình Pascal, xâu kí tự có tối đa ? A 255 kí tự; B 256 kí tự; C 16 kí tự; D kí tự; Câu 2: Trong ngơn ngữ lập trình Pascal, khai báo khai báo sau SAI khai báo xâu kí tự ? A VAR S : STRING[256]; B VAR X1 : STRING[1]; C VAR X1 : STRING[100]; D VAR S : STRING; Câu 3: Cho khai báo mảng đoạn chương trình sau: VAR A : ARRAY[0 50] OF real; BEGIN k := 0; FOR i:= TO 50 DO IF A[i] > A[k] THEN k := i; END Đoạn chương trình thực cơng việc ? A Tìm phần tử nhỏ mảng B Tìm phần tử lớn mảng C Tìm số phần tử nhỏ mảng D Tìm số phần tử lớn mảng Câu 4: Trong ngơn ngữ lập trình Pascal, với khai báo sau : Type mang = ARRAY[1 100] of integer ; Var a, b : mang ; c : array[1 100] of integer ; Câu lệnh hợp lệ ? A b := c ; B a := b ; C a := c ; D c := b ; Câu 5: Trong ngôn ngữ lập trình Pascal, sau thực đoạn chương trình sau, biến X có giá trị gì? S := ‘Hoang Anh Tuan’ ; X := ‘ ’ ; i := length(S) ; while S[i] ‘ ’ Begin X := X + S[i] ; i := i + ; End ; A ‘Anh’ B Xâu rỗng C ‘Hoang’ D ‘Tuan’ Câu 6: Cho ST xâu kí tự, đoạn chương trình sau thực cơng việc gì? FOR i := LENGTH(ST) DOWNTO DO write(ST[i]) ; A In kí tự hình theo thứ tự ngược, trừ kí tự đầu tiên; B In kí tự xâu hình; C In xâu hình; D In kí tự hình theo thứ tự ngược; Câu 7: Trong ngơn ngữ lập trình Pascal, trình nhập liệu mảng chiều A, để phần tử hiển thị cửa sổ chương trình ta viết lệnh sau: A Write(“ A[ ” , i ,“ ]= ”); readln(A[i]); B Write(‘ A[ i ]= ’); readln(A[i]); C Write(‘ A[ ’ i ‘ ]= ’);readln(A[i]); D Write(‘ A[ ’ , i , ‘ ]= ’); readln(A[i]); Câu 8: Trong ngôn ngữ lập trình Pascal, đoạn chương trình sau thực cơng việc ? X := length(S) ; For i := X downto If S[i] = ‘ ’ then Delete(S, i, 1) ; { ‘ ’ dấu cách } A Xóa dấu cách xâu ký tự S B Xóa dấu cách vị trí cuối xâu S C Xóa dấu cách xâu S D Xóa dấu cách thừa xâu ký tự S Câu 9: Trong ngơn ngữ lập trình Pascal, sau chương trình thực xong đoạn chương trình sau, giá trị biến S ? S := ‘Ha Noi Mua thu’; Trang 1/2 - Mã đề thi 061 Delete(S,7,8); Insert(‘Mua thu’, S, 1); A Ha Noi Mua thu; B Mua thu Ha Noi; C Ha Noi; D Mua thu Ha Noi mua thu; Câu 10: Trong ngơn ngữ lập trình Pascal, xâu kí tự khơng có kí tự gọi ? A Xâu trắng; B Xâu không; C Xâu rỗng; D Không phải xâu kí tự; Câu 11: Cho khai báo sau: VAR hoten : STRING; Phát biểu đúng? A Xâu có độ dài lớn 0; B Câu lệnh sai thiếu độ dài tối đa xâu; C Cần phải khai báo kích thước xâu sau đó; D Xâu có độ dài lớn 255; Câu 12: Trong ngơn ngữ lập trình Pascal, để in xâu kí tự hình theo thứ tự ngược lại ký tự xâu (vd : abcd thi in dcba), đoạn chương sau thực việc ? A For i := length(S) downto write(S) B For i := length(S) downto write(S[i]) C For i := to length(S) write(S[i]) D For i := to length(S) div write(S[i]) Câu 13: Phát biểu sau kiểu mảng SAI? A Độ dài tối đa mảng 255; B Có thể xây dựng mảng nhiều chiều; C Chỉ số mảng không thiết 1; D Xâu kí tự xem loại mảng; Câu 14: Cho xâu S:= ‘Ha_Noi_Mua_Thu’; Kết trả cho S câu lệnh DELETE(S,7,10); A Ha_Noi B Ha_noi C Ha Noi D Lỗi cú pháp Câu 15: Trong ngôn ngữ lập trình Pascal, đoạn chương trình sau thực việc việc sau ( A mảng số có N phần tử) ? S := ; For i := to N S := S + A[i] ; A Tính tổng phần tử mảng A; B Không thực việc việc C Đếm số phần tử mảng A; D In hình mảng A; Câu 16: Đoạn chương trình sau in kết ? Program Welcome ; Var a : string[10]; Begin a := ‘tinhoc ’;writeln(length(a)); End A Chương trình có lỗi; B 6; C 10; D 7; Câu 17: Cho xâu S ‘AbABabABab’ Kết hàm POS(‘AB’,S) là: A 1; B 5; C 8; D 3; Câu 18: Cho khai báo mảng sau: VAR M: ARRAY[0 10] OF Integer ; Phương án phần tử thứ 10 mảng ? A M[9]; B M(9); C M(10); D M[10]; Câu 19: Cho khai báo sau : VAR A: ARRAY[0 16] OF Integer ; Câu lệnh in tất phần tử mảng trên? A FOR k := 16 DOWNTO DO write(a[k]); B FOR k:= TO 15 DO write(a[k]); C FOR k := 16 DOWN TO write(a[k]); D FOR k := TO 16 DO write(a[k]); Câu 20: Trong ngôn ngữ lập trình Pascal, đoạn chương trình sau thực cơng việc gì? A Xóa ký tự số; C Đếm số dấu cách có xâu; B Đếm số ký tự có xâu; D Xóa dấu cách xâu; - HẾT -Trang 2/2 - Mã đề thi 061

Ngày đăng: 01/04/2019, 10:11

TỪ KHÓA LIÊN QUAN

w